What are the rights of people with diverse sexual orientation and gender identity in Honduras?

In Honduras, people with diverse sexual orientation and gender identity face challenges in protecting their rights. There are no specific laws that protect against discrimination based on sexual orientation or gender identity, and cases of violence and discrimination have been documented. However, civil society organizations and activists work to promote equality and non-discrimination.

What are the rights of children born from extramarital relationships in Paraguay in terms of surname?

Children born from extramarital relationships in Paraguay have the right to bear their father's surname, as long as he legally recognizes it. The legislation seeks to avoid discrimination and guarantee equal rights regarding affiliation.

What are the requirements to request a judicial record certificate in the Dominican Republic?

The requirements to apply for a judicial record certificate in the Dominican Republic generally include valid identification, such as an identification card or passport, payment of the corresponding fee, and completing the application form provided by the Attorney General's Office.

How is it determined who is considered a Politically Exposed Person in Colombia?

In Colombia, the definition and classification of Politically Exposed Persons is established by Law 1762 of 2015 and its regulatory decrees. This law establishes the criteria to identify PEPs, including the positions and functions that qualify them as such. In addition, there are updated databases and lists that financial institutions consult to verify if a client is considered a Politically Exposed Person.
